Nigerian actor who worked in Bollywood films held at Delhi’s IGI airport

Speed News Desk | Updated on: 25 October 2019, 12:13 IST

A Nigerian actor has been detained by CISF personnel at the Delhi airport on Thursday. He was apprehended for allegedly overstaying in the country, officials said.

Police officials said Olamilekan M Akanbi Ojora was arrested around 4 am at the Indira Gandhi International Airport (IGAI) after security personnel found him roaming suspiciously in the terminal area.


Ojara had a ticket to Goa via Vistara airlines flight and when he was questioned, he said that his visa had expired, an official said.

CISF also confirmed with the immigration and central intelligence agencies about Nigeria celebrity’s visa expired date.

 

 

The officials of immigration and central intelligence agencies said that Ojora’s visa had expired in 2011.

“The man enjoys celebrity status in his country and has also acted in some Hindi movies. He was living in India illegally,” a senior CISF officer said.

Meanwhile, CISF personnel has handed over him to intelligence bureau officials for further investigation.
